BMW’s second-generation X2 is set to launch in late 2024, featuring enhanced design, advanced technology, and diverse powertrain options. While the global launch is set for 2024, the X2 could come to India after its release in other markets.

BMW is set to launch the second generation of its pioneering coupe SUV, the BMW X2, in late 2024. Having introduced the coupe SUV concept to the premium compact segment, the new X2 features significant enhancements in design, performance, and technology.
Design & Exterior
The new BMW X2 showcases a prominent coupe silhouette with increased dimensions—194mm longer, 21mm wider, and 64mm taller than its predecessor. The updated styling includes a coupe-like roofline that flows seamlessly into the rear, an upright front profile, flared wheel arches, and a muscular rear profile, giving the crossover a strong and bold visual appearance.
Additional design features include updated LED headlamps and taillights, and an optional illuminated kidney grille. The X2 is also the first compact crossover from BMW to offer optional 21-inch wheels. The clean surface design, minimal dynamic lines, and integrated door handles enhance the car's aerodynamic efficiency.
Interior & Features
Inside, the new BMW X2 offers more space and advanced technology. The cabin is equipped with the BMW Curved Display, combining a 10.25-inch instrument cluster and a 10.7-inch touchscreen infotainment display into a single glass panel. The car features BMW iDrive 9, focusing on touch and voice control through the BMW Intelligent Personal Assistant.
New features include a cabin-facing camera for taking photos and recording videos. The interior design emphasizes modernity and convenience, ensuring a premium experience for the occupants.
Powertrain & Performance
The second-generation BMW X2 offers a range of powertrain options, including petrol, diesel, and electric variants.
X2 xDrive28i: Powered by a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ine, this base variant produces 237 bhp and 400 Nm of torque, accelerating from 0-96 kmph in 6.2 seconds.
X2 M35i xDrive: This top variant features a more potent 2.0-liter engine, delivering 307 bhp and 400 Nm of torque, reaching 0-96 kmph in 5.2 seconds. Both versions come with a seven-speed dual-clutch transmission.
iX2 xDrive30: The electric variant includes dual drive units producing 313 bhp, achieving 0-100 kmph in 5.6 seconds. It is equipped with a 64.8kWh battery, offering a claimed range of 417 to 449 kilometers.
Dimensions & Cargo Capacity
The new X2 has grown significantly, with a length of 179.8 inches and a wheelbase 0.9 inches longer than the outgoing model. This increase in dimensions results in more interior space for occupants. The cargo capacity ranges from 560 to 1,470 liters, providing flexibility and practicality for various needs.
Launch & Market Position
BMW has been actively teasing the second-generation X2 over the last few weeks, with its public debut scheduled for the upcoming Japan Mobility Show in Tokyo. While the global launch is set for 2024, the X2 could come to India after its release in other markets.
